Haworth is a borough in Bergen County, in the New York metro area.
The community was named after Haworth, England.
The latitude of Haworth is 40.960N. The longitude is -73.99W.
It is in the Eastern Standard time zone. Elevation is 66 feet.The estimated population, in 2003, was 3,407.

At the time of the 2000 census, the per capita income in Haworth was $45,615, compared with $21,587 nationally.
57% of Haworth residents age 25 and older have a bachelor's or advanced college degree.
Median rent in Haworth, at the time of the 2000 Census, was $1,250. Monthly homeowner costs, for people with mortgages, were $2,437.

The average commute time for Haworth workers is 34 minutes, compared with 26 minutes nationwide.
